  • Publication number: 20180070670
    Abstract: An insole providing cushioning and control of foot motion, which includes a stability cradle and a lateral midfoot/heel pad secured to the underside of the base of the insole, as well as a supplemental heel pad is also attached to lay over a portion of the lateral midfoot/heel pad. The lateral midfoot/heel pad and supplemental heel pad are constructed of materials to help control foot pronation and supination.

  • Patent number: 9788602
    Abstract: An insole which provides cushioning and support to a user's foot subjected to a high magnitude of ground reaction forces (GRF) encountered in playing court sports, such as basketball, is herein disclosed. The insole comprises a base having a bottom side which defines recesses adapted to receive pads having particular properties. The location and materials of the various pads and pods work together to provide ground reaction force modulation to the user's foot which is highly desirable for users engaged in basketball and similar activities.

  • Publication number: 20170027277
    Abstract: This invention provides for individualized adjustment to a user's specific needs through the use of multiple variable size, thickness and rigidity components that can be placed or integrated into an insole. The current invention is an insole that incorporates, but is not limited to: (1) a base layer with various depressions, (2) a metatarsal dome, (3) a first metatarsal head pad, (2) a forefoot wedge to create a pronation moment around the midfoot joint, (3) a heel cushion, (4) a heel lift to raise the heel area of the foot, (5) a rearfoot wedge to increase the supination moments around the subtalar joint, and (6) an arch support of a specific stiffness or with varying stiffness.

  • Publication number: 20160073730
    Abstract: A contoured insole especially advantageous for users with medium to high arches is disclosed. It comprises a generally foot-shaped base extending from a heel end to a toe end, which comprises a top surface and a bottom surface. The bottom surface of the base preferably further comprises two indentations formed integrally therein in a forefoot area and a heel area. A forefoot pad and a heel pad are secured to each of said indentations. Preferably, the base is made from a polyurethane foam. The pads are made from rubber or synthetic rubber. A top sheet is coextensive with and secured to the top surface of the base. The top sheet is generally a fabric which preferably has antimicrobial characteristics. In use, the foot of the wearer, with or without a sock or stocking thereon, rests upon the top sheet in the foot-receiving compartment of a user's shoe.

  • Publication number: 20150201702
    Abstract: An insole for placement inside a shoe for use in reducing over-pronation, associated misalignment of the patella (knee cap), and knee joint stress of a user. The insole has a top sheet and a support base cushion. The support base cushion has a forefoot mid-cushion area that extends from a toe end to a metatarsal area of the insole and an arch to heel area that extends from a metatarsal area to a heel end of the insole. The insole has a forefoot cushion secured to the forefoot mid-cushion area. The insole also has a medial support cradle, which reduces over-pronation and knee stresses, a lateral support cradle, which provides a side support to help reduce stress on the knee, and a heel cushion, which acts in cooperation with the medial support cradle to resist excessive pronation, all secured to the bottom of the support base cushion in the arch to heel area.
